Output 81ab7c296ced17626e67518a5d8909ac12517969d0c45ae1fd72c520ba3e21a3:0

value
420434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 061a704577e4a76923fdea61b706a7ef600c7f6e OP_EQUAL
address
32FHegHM7WZzJWTwm3nT2S89CR98aQkq3k
transaction
81ab7c296ced17626e67518a5d8909ac12517969d0c45ae1fd72c520ba3e21a3
spent
true